The brief and dramatic prophecy of Nahum is a declaration of the Lord’s final judgement of Nineveh, capital of Assyria. This was carried out to the letter in 612 BC, and the world rejoiced in the demise of that ruthless power: “Everyone who hears the news about you claps his hands at your fall, for who has not felt your endless cruelty?” (Nah. 3:19). God is willing to forgive even Nineveh - the book of Jonah testifies to that. However, when Nineveh reverts to and persists in her evil ways, God is against her. “The Lord is slow to anger and great in power; the Lord will not leave the guilty unpunished” (Nah. 1:3). Again, “The Lord is good, a refuge in times of trouble. He cares for those who trust in him, but with an overwhelming flood he will make an end of Nineveh” (Nah. 1:7-8). There is great comfort in knowing that the Lord is against Nineveh. “Endless cruelty” - history testifies that that is an apt description of that ruthless empire, and when God’s wrath is poured out upon her, we say, “Amen!” That “the wrath of God is being revealed from heaven” (Rom. 1:18) is a solemn thought, and yet it is a source of deep satisfaction, for it spells the doom of every Nineveh.
